During the 2022-2023 academic year, part-time undergraduate students at UPR Utuado paid an average of $157 per credit hour. No discount was available for in-state students.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.
| In State | Out of State | |
|---|---|---|
| Tuition | $5,024 | $5,024 |
| Fees | $300 | $300 |
| Books and Supplies | $4,168 | $4,168 |

During the 2021-2022 academic year, 2 liberal arts / sciences & humanities majors earned their associate's degree from UPR Utuado. Of these graduates, 50% were men and 50% were women.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Puerto Rico - Utuado with a associate's in liberal arts / sciences & humanities.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 0 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
| White | 0 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 1 |
